> > > Hi MXNet Community,
> > >
> > > Apache MXNet (incubating) has been an incubating project since January,
> > > 2017[1]. Since then, the project has matured and adopted the Apache
> > > Software Foundation’s principles and philosophy around building and
> > > maintaining open source software. There is a thriving community of
> > > developers and users from all over the world that regularly contribute
> to
> > > the project.
> > >
> > > Here is a brief overview of the progress of the Apache MXNet
> (incubating)
> > > project and community since entering the incubator:
> > >
> > > Community
> > >
> > >    -
> > >
> > >    37 new PPMC members were added, bringing the total number of PPMC
> > >    members to 50
> > >    -
> > >
> > >    55 new committers were added (which include new PPMC members),
> bringing
> > >    the total number of committers to 86
> > >    -
> > >
> > >    The total number of contributors is now 870 and growing.
> > >    -
> > >
> > >    The dev@mxnet mailing list[2] currently has X subscribers, and all
> > > major
> > >    project discussions happen there.
> > >
> > > Project
> > >
> > >    -
> > >
> > >    18 releases[3] by 13 different release managers. All compliance
> issues
> > >    have been resolved with the 1.9.0 and 2.0.beta releases.
> > >    -
> > >
> > >    MXNet website[4] is now compliant with Apache Project Website
> > >    requirements[5]
> > >    -
> > >
> > >    MXNet has completed the project maturity self assessment[6]
> > >
> > > Concerns
> > >
> > > Although I think most of the issues noted below have been resolved, I
> did
> > > want to bring up a few problems that have been identified with the
> project
> > > in the past.
> > >
> > > Licensing and Branding Issues
> > >
> > > The IPMC brought up some release and branding issues and filed a JIRA
> > > ticket[7] back in June, 2020. The community addressed the concerns but
> the
> > > ticket remains open.
> > >
> > > We also went through an extensive license audit throughout the 1.9.0
> > > release[8][9], switch from using a DISCLAIMER-WIP to DISCLAIMER and
> added
> > > automated license checking tools to prevent future licensing issues
> from
> > > being introduced.  We are confident we now comply with ASF
> requirements and
> > > have the tools in-place to stay compliant.
> > >
> > > Distribution Rights and IP Clearance
> > >
> > > Our project status page[1] does not have dates under the Copyright and
> > > Verify Distribution Rights sections. Based on the ticket[10] when the
> > > source code was initially imported, an SGA was not required since MXNet
> > > wasn’t developed by a commercial entity. Since the code was already
> Apache
> > > 2.0 licensed, there was not a formal IP Clearance process completed.
> Based
> > > on the extensive license audit completed for the 1.9.0 release, I
> believe
> > > we can use the date when the release passed the general@incubator vote
> > > when
> > > the Distribution Rights were verified. Unless there are objections, I
> will
> > > get these dates set on the status page after this discussion has
> completed.
